Hello,
I am trying to install Apache Metron in a cluster created with Ambari and HDP 2.6.5.0.
When I select Metron as a service to install, I get stuck when trying to get to the next step, the next button shows as always disabled. This is not happening with any other service.

The component list is extracted from the configuration being made in the web, so the question would be: Why 'METRON_INDEXING', 'METRON_PARSING', 'METRON_REST', 'METRON_MANAGEMENT_UI'... are not appearing as services?
The only services that appear are PCAP, PROFILER and ENRICHEMENT:
Created 07-22-2020 05:44 AM
The real problem was the Ambari version, that is not compatible with Metron.
From Ambari 2.7 onwards, all this problems arise, so the maximum compatible version for now is Ambari 2.6.X
